“He’s lucky to have you.”
Martin Ramirez frequently heard those words from his well-intentioned friends. After all, raising a boy with Down’s syndrome is a challenge, if not a burden, right? Not so fast, says Ramirez. In fact, Ramirez insists that he’s the lucky one, because his son, Mario, has taught him far-reaching lessons that have enriched his life beyond measure. CREDENTIALS: Martin Ramirez is on the Lucas Count Board of Mental Retardation and Developmental Disabilities, and served as the past president of the Lucas County Collaborative Network of Northwest Ohio’s Executive Board, which serves children at risk. Ramirez was also chairman of the Diversity Committee of the Toledo, Ohio post office. Ramirez is the father of a special needs son, as well as two other boys. He chronicles his life with his special needs son in his book LIVING IT UP WITH DOWNS: How My Son Became My Mentor.
